Transforming Cancer Care Through CAR T Cells
CAR T-cell therapy represents a groundbreaking advancement in the fight against cancer. This innovative therapy harnesses the power of a patient's own immune system to eliminate cancerous cells. The process involves genetically engineering T-cells, a type of white blood cell, to express chimeric antigen receptors (CARs). These CARs are designed to bind to unique antigens present on the surface of cancer cells. Once these engineered T-cells are transplanted back into the patient's body, they can expand and actively seek out and destroy the cancerous cells.
CAR T-cell therapy has shown remarkable results in treating certain types of blood cancers, including leukemia and lymphoma. In some cases, it has resulted in complete remission, offering hope for patients who have run out of other treatment options.

Emerging Applications of CAR T-Cell Therapy Exploiting Blood Cancers
While CAR T-cell therapy has demonstrated remarkable success in treating hematological malignancies, its potential extends far beyond the realm of blood cancers. Clinical experts are actively exploring novel applications for this transformative immunotherapy in a broad range of solid tumors, autoimmune diseases, and even infectious conditions. The inherent adaptability of CAR T-cells, coupled with ongoing advances in engineering and delivery strategies, paves the way for revolutionary treatments that could reshape the landscape of medicine. Preclinical studies have shown promising results in targeting solid tumors such as lung cancer, melanoma, and glioblastoma, suggesting that CAR T-cell therapy may soon become a valuable tool in the fight against these challenging diseases. Furthermore, the potential to harness CAR T-cells to target specific immune checkpoints or inflammatory pathways holds significant promise for managing autoimmune disorders and mitigating transplant rejection. As research progresses, we can anticipate a growth of CAR T-cell applications that will revolutionize the way we approach various medical challenges.
